Brief Summary
Review the sponsor-provided synopsis that highlights what the study is about and why it is being conducted.
Data were recorded including age, gender, duration of anesthesia, duration of surgery, postoperative analgesia consumption, complications such as respiratory distress due to hemidiaphragmatic paralysis and complications such as hematoma and nerve damage due to block intervention.

Study Groups
Review each arm or cohort in the study, along with the interventions and objectives associated with them.
GROUP I
Interscalene block (group I)15 ml of 0.5% bupivacaine was applied with a single injection to 12 of 18 patients,
perineural injection
perineural injection of local anesthestetic for postoperative pain management
GROUP II
7.5 ml of interscalene and 7.5 ml of suprascapular block (GROUP II) were applied to 6 patients with posterior approach.
